Integração ERP da Olist com a Anyshop

Integração desenvolvida pela Anyshop, através da nossa API de integração.
Recursos disponíveis
| Receber pedidos Solução desenvolvida pela Anyshop | ✔ |
| Receber produtos Solução desenvolvida pela Anyshop | ✔ |
| Enviar produtos | ✔ |
| Enviar estoque | ✔ |
| Enviar preços | ✔ |
| Sincronizar situação | ✔ |
Configuração no ERP
Configurar integração com a Anyshop
- Acesse as configurações de e-commerce do ERP em Menu → Configurações → Aba E-commerce → Integrações.
Agora, clique no botão Incluir integração para adicionar as configurações de integração.
Caso já possua integrações configuradas em sua conta, as mesmas serão exibidas e indicadas com suas respectivas situações.
Cada situação indica:
- Ativa: Representa que a configuração da integração foi realizada com sucesso e a mesma encontra-se pronta para uso.
- Inativa: Indica a inatividade desta loja no ERP, a mesma não será utilizada ou mostrada para sincronização de pedidos, produtos e demais ações pertinentes.
- Não configurada: Esta situação indica que a configuração ainda não foi realizada.
- Não instalada: Representa que ainda não houve a comunicação com o e-commerce para ativar a integração.
- Na aba Integração , selecione Anyshop no campo Integração. Abaixo, no campo Nome informe o nome da sua loja.
Em Configurações , defina os seguintes campos abaixo:
Sincronização de produtos
| Enviar dias para preparação ao sincronizar | Habilite a opção para enviar a informação do campo Dias para preparação no envio de produtos para Americanas Marketplace. Para preencher este campo, acesse o Cadastro do seu produto , clique em Editar e na aba Dados gerais , na seção Estoque preencha o campo Dias para preparação. Lembramos que esse campo pode ser alimentado por planilha e será inserido também nas APIs de cálculos dos fretes (Carrefour, por exemplo). |
|---|
Sincronização de pedidos
| Enviar rastreamento ao alterar a situação no ERP para enviado | Se este parâmetro estiver ativo, sempre que o pedido for alterado para Enviado no ERP, o código de rastreio será enviado de forma automática para a plataforma. Saiba mais sobre essa rotina através da ajuda Atualizar situação de envio dos pedidos. |
|---|
Notificações por e-mail
| Enviar e-mail de rastreamento ao alterar a situação no ERP para enviado | Se este parâmetro estiver ativo, sempre que o pedido for alterado para Enviado no ERP, o código de rastreio será enviado de forma automática via e-mail conforme layout estabelecido nas configurações da expedição. |
|---|---|
| Enviar e-mail de entrega ao alterar a situação no ERP para entregue | Ao habilitar este parâmetro, sempre que um pedido for alterado para a situação Entregue no ERP, será enviado de forma automática um e-mail conforme layout estabelecido nas configurações da expedição. |
- Na aba Estoque, defina os seguintes campos:
| Atualizar estoque na loja virtual a partir do ERP | Selecione a opção Enviar saldo físico sempre que houver alguma movimentação de estoque de um produto no ERP, o saldo em estoque desse produto será automaticamente atualizado na loja virtual. |
|---|---|
| Depósito a ser considerado na integração |
Escolha qual será o depósito padrão para as ações: Importar pedido , Importar produtos e Enviar estoque. * O campo Depósito a ser considerado na integração será exibido nas contas que possuem a extensão Depósitos de estoque instalada |
Na aba Dados Fiscais , no campo Natureza de operação para venda desta integração selecione uma Natureza de venda padrão para essa plataforma. A natureza selecionada será atribuída na Importação dos pedidos no ERP e no momento em que gerar a Nota Fiscal através do pedido importado.
Observação:
Além disso, você pode Habilitar ou Desabilitar o campo Definir natureza de operação diferente para destinatários contribuintes do ICMS. Habilitando esse campo, você poderá selecionar uma natureza de operação específica, a qual será aplicada no momento em que o ERP identificar que o pedido de venda trata-se de um cliente contribuinte.
Na aba Notificações preencha os campos URL do notificações de estoque , URL para envio de produtos , URL para envio de rastreio , URL para envio da nota fiscal , URL para envio de preços com as URLs utilizadas para webhook de sua loja virtual.
Observação:
Estes links devem ser solicitados ao suporte da Anyshop.
Ao final, não esqueça de Salvar as configurações.
Adicionar extensão token api
Inicie adicionando a extensão Token API em sua conta. Para isso acesse Menu → Início → Loja de extensões.
Na seção Vendas , adicione a extensão Token API.
Agora, clique em Instalar e Confirme a instalação da extensão.
Gerar token api
Acesse as configurações de e-commerce do ERP em Menu → Configurações → Aba E-commerce → Token API.
No campo Token , encontra-se o Token identificador da sua conta.
Esse token deve ser adicionado no momento que instalar o aplicativo do ERP na Anyshop, conforme orientação Aplicativo ERP.
Como enviar produtos do ERP para Anyshop
Enviar apenas um produto
Para enviar apenas um produto para Anyshop, acesse em Menu → Cadastros → Produtos.
Agora, acesse o Menu de contexto do produto e clique em Enviar para o e-commerce.
A seguir, no campo Plataforma selecione sua loja Anyshop e marque a opção Atualizar estoque no e-commerce. Após isso, clique em Avançar.
Valide se o produto esta com as informações corretas para envio clique em Enviar.
Campos enviados:
- Descrição
- Descrição complementar
- Código
- Unidade
- Preço
- Preço promocional
- NCM
- Origem
- GTIN
- GTIN Embalagem
- Localização
- Peso líquido
- Peso bruto
- Estoque
- Situação
- Imagens
- CEST
- Marca
- Dimensões
- Categoria
- Variações
Enviar produtos selecionados
Para enviar o cadastro de produtos do ERP para Anyshop, acesse em Menu → Cadastros → Produtos → Selecione os produtos que deseja enviar → Enviar para e-commerce.
A seguir, no campo Plataforma selecione sua loja Anyshop e marque a opção Atualizar estoque no e-commerce. Após isso, clique em Avançar.
Valide se o produto esta com as informações corretas para envio clique em Enviar.
Campos enviados:
- Descrição
- Descrição complementar
- Código
- Unidade
- Preço
- Preço promocional
- NCM
- Origem
- GTIN
- GTIN Embalagem
- Localização
- Peso líquido
- Peso bruto
- Estoque
- Situação
- Imagens
- CEST
- Marca
- Dimensões
- Categoria
- Variações
Como mapear o cadastro dos produtos para integração do estoque
Para mapear o cadastro de um produto que já está no ERP e na Anyshop, você deverá acessar as ações do produto na plataforma e depois, clicar em Setar SKUs.
Acesse o item no ERP e Copie o ID do produto que está sendo exibido na URL da página acessada.
No campo SKU ERP , insira o ID do produto no ERP.
Feito esse processo na Anyshop, Edite o produto no ERP e na aba Anúncios , insira um novo mapeamento.
No campo Identificador , insira o mesmo ID que você inseriu na Anyshop.
Aplique e Salve as alterações.
Como visualizar os pedidos do e-commerce no ERP
Caso nas configurações da Anyshop o campo Enviar pedidos estiver marcado como Sim , cada vez que um novo pedido for gerado, o mesmo será enviado automaticamente para o ERP.
Para visualizar os pedidos, acesse sua conta no ERP em Menu → Vendas → Pedidos de venda.
Configuração na Anyshop
Como integrar o ERP com a plataforma Anyshop
Para isso, acesse Menu → Integrações.
Clique em ERP → Configurações gerais.
Agora, no campo Token , adicione o Token que gerou no passo Gerar Token Api.
No campo Identificador do integrador informe o Identificador do integrador da plataforma cadastrada no ERP.
Salve as alterações.
Informações relacionadas
Cadastrando os produtos no ERP
Quando você opta por integrar o ERP à Anyshop , alguns dados são sincronizados entre as duas plataformas, evitando que você precise fazer o cadastro de produtos duas vezes.
É importante que você entenda quais campos serão sincronizados. Segue abaixo a lista com a especificação de cada campo:
- Descrição
- Descrição complementar
- Código
- Unidade
- Preço
- Preço promocional
- NCM
- Origem
- GTIN
- GTIN Embalagem
- Localização
- Peso líquido
- Peso bruto
- Estoque
- Situação
- Imagens
- CEST
- Marca
- Dimensões
- Categoria
- Variações
Saiba como cadastrar no ERP produtos Simples e com Variações.
Enviar estoque dos produtos no ERP ao e-commerce
Enviar quantidade em estoque em lote
Para realizar o envio da quantidade em estoque dos produtos ao e-commerce em lote, acesse em Menu → Cadastros → Produtos → Selecione os produtos → Mais Ações → Enviar estoque ao e-commerce.
Agora, no campo Plataforma você pode selecionar mais do que uma integração para o envio da quantidade em estoque dos produtos. Na lista que será exibida, selecione as integrações que deseja enviar a quantidade em estoque.
Após selecionar as integrações, defina se será enviado o saldo Físico ou Disponível dos produtos.
Clique no botão Selecionar. A seguir, serão exibidos os dados deste produto como: Identificador do anúncio, Descrição, Código (SKU) e Preço.
Para concluir o processo de envio, clique em Enviar.
Enviar quantidade em estoque de forma individual
Caso queira enviar somente a quantidade em estoque de um produto específico, acesse o Menu de contexto do produto e clique em Enviar estoque ao e-commerce.
No campo Plataforma você pode selecionar mais do que uma integração para o envio da quantidade em estoque do produto. Na lista que será exibida, selecione aquelas que deseja enviar a quantidade em estoque.
Após selecionar as integrações, defina se será enviado o saldo Físico ou Disponível dos produtos.
Clique no botão Selecionar. A seguir, serão exibidos os dados deste produto como: Identificador do anúncio, Descrição, Código (SKU) e Preço.
Para concluir o processo de envio, clique em Enviar.
Enviar preço dos produtos no ERP ao e-commerce
Enviar preços em lote
Para realizar o envio dos preços dos produtos ao e-commerce em lote, acesse em Menu → Cadastros → Produtos → Selecione os produtos → Mais Ações → Enviar preços para o e-commerce.
Agora, no campo Plataforma você pode selecionar mais do que uma integração para o envio dos preços. Na lista que será exibida, selecione aquelas que deseja enviar os preços desses produtos.
Após definir para qual ou quais integrações receberão o envio dos preços, clique em Selecionar.
Para concluir o processo de envio, clique em Enviar.
Enviar preço de forma individual
Caso queira enviar somente o preço de um produto em específico, acesse o Menu de contexto do produto e clique em Enviar preços para o e-commerce.
Agora, no campo Plataforma você pode selecionar mais do que uma integração para o envio dos preços. Na lista que será exibida, selecione aquelas que deseja enviar os preços desses produtos.
Após definir para qual ou quais integrações receberão o envio dos preços, clique em Selecionar.
Para concluir o processo de envio, clique em Enviar.
Reajustar preço dos produtos no ERP e atualizar no e-commerce
Para realizar os ajustes nos preços dos produtos cadastrados no ERP e após atualizar na loja virtual, acesse em Cadastros → Produtos → Mais ações → Reajustar preço dos produtos.
Utilize as opções de Filtros caso deseje, ou clique direto em Listar produtos.
Após isso, será exibido a lista dos produtos, clique em Informar reajuste.
Selecione os produtos que deseja atualizar os preços, utilize uma das opções disponíveis para atualizar os preços, por reajuste de Percentual , ou adicione o novo preço em cada produto na coluna Novo preço , marque a opção Atualizar preços no e-commerce e selecione a integração correspondente, por fim clique em Salvar.
Enviar código de rastreio ao e-commerce
Atenção!
Para enviar o código de rastreamento para Anyshop, é preciso informar no pedido ou nota fiscal o transportador, sendo ele Correios ou Transportadora. O campo será preenchido no Pedido de Venda ou na Nota Fiscal e por fim, gerar o agrupamento (PLP ou Coleta) no módulo de Expedição. Veja como gerar a Expedição.
Acesse o módulo de Expedição, Selecione a forma de envio → Aba Concluídas → Clique no menu de contexto ao lado da expedição gerada → Enviar código de rastreio para o e-commerce.
Observação:
Ao enviar o código de rastreio, os pedidos são marcados como Processados na Anyshop.
Após isso, ao acessar a expedição será adicionado um Marcador que identifica quando o código de rastreio já foi enviado para Anyshop.
Enviar dados da chave de acesso ao e-commerce
Ao utilizar a integração com a Anyshop, assim que as notas forem emitidas através das vendas importadas de sua plataforma, os dados das notas fiscais serão enviados de forma automática.
Dicas e informações adicionais
- Caso seja necessário realizar a exclusão dos mapeamentos dos produtos com a sua plataforma, acesse Configurações → Aba E-commerce → Integrações e marque a integração desejada. Depois, clique em Mais ações → Excluir todos os anúncios no ERP. É importante mencionar que esta ação, depois de concluída, não poderá ser desfeita.
- Os campos sincronizados devem ser corrigidos/modificados apenas no ERP. Caso você corrija/modifique alguma destas informações no painel de controle da Anyshop, estas informações serão sobrescritas pelos dados cadastrados no ERP assim que rodar a próxima rotina de sincronização.
- Sempre que um pedido é importado, o cliente automaticamente é cadastrado em Cadastros → Clientes e fornecedores.